West Coast IPA with Nelson Sauvin™, Motueka™, CIP 014 & CIP 076

A series showcasing the unique terroir & dedicated growers of New Zealand; brewed in collaboration with Clayton Hops.
Based in the Tasman region, Clayton are the largest hop grower in New Zealand, harvesting from over 1300 acres. Their innovation project is producing exciting new breeds for us to explore & here we’re showcasing two of them.
Super high in thiol precursors, CIP 014 is a unique bio-transformative addition for the classic NZ Sauvignon character, while 076's high oil content lends a fragrance of orange blossom & ripe peach.

Bright, Pink grapefruit & Lychee

Can. Just a mild haze on this gold beer, small bubbly off white head. Light palate, a little dry, good superfine carbonation. Thin pale malts, a thin creamy sweetness. Not the worst choice for this brew but, could definitely do with some more body. Soft pine. Juicy lychee led stone fruits and tropical fruits. Mild hop spice. A touch of ripe white wine. Light and semi dry finish. Nice brew. If you ain't paying attention, you might miss the fact this one contains experimental hops CIP014 and CIP076. Whilst I didn't get all the flavours they claim, the overall flavours they deliver are interesting, especially the lychee.

440ml can. Clear golden with a white head. Aroma of orange, grapefruit, white wine. Taste of grapefruit juice, orange and peel, white wine, resinous piney bitterness. Medium bodied. Lovely westie.
